Alpha Assembly Solutions will feature its silver sintering technology for power electronics at Booth #212 during the Electric & Hybrid Vehicle Technology Expo being held in Novi, Michigan, on September 11-13, 2018.

"ALPHA Argomax is proving to be the go-to solution for traction inverters used in electric drivetrain applications, and we are excited for the opportunity to work with the many innovative companies in this space," said Paul Koep, Americas business market manager, for die attach solutions at Alpha. "The unique combination of our broad product portfolio, sintering process knowledge and package design insight accelerates our customers‘ ability to launch high performance products with extremely aggressive timelines."

There is an unprecidented level of activity in the electrification space, from OEM, Tier 1 and many new players offering various levels of integration and expertise. Alpha is extremely pleased with the reception it is receiving across this supply chain and with the success our customers are experiencing. 

Customers also benefit from Alpha’s network of equipment partners, who have developed sintering systems that achieve high throughtput and high yield.

"Having worked with a broad group of equipment partners, we understand the production impact of sinter process decisions as well as package design tradeoffs. Our approach is to verify the sinter process in our lab with the customer’s material set, and work closely with customers to ensure the process we develop and final package design enables a high level of manufacturability and reliability," said Koep.

Alpha, a MacDermid Performance Solutions Business, is a leader in developing innovative material solutions that serve the highest performance, reliability, and environmental requirements of industry leading companies, including the rapidly expanding electric and hybrid vehicle market. Alpha’s portfolio of Argomax advanced sintering products provides the ability for high power switching applications to achieve the highest power density, and highest electrical conductivity, while providing an unprecidented improvement in power cycling reliability.

About Alpha Assembly Solutions

Alpha Assembly Solutions, part of the MacDermid Performance Solutions group of businesses, is the world leader in the development, manufacturing and sales of innovative specialty materials used for electronics assembly, die attach and semiconductor packaging in a wide range of industry segments, including automotive, communications, computers, consumer, power electronics, LED lighting, photovoltaics, and others.

As the electronics industry continues to evolve, Alpha is focused on developing novel and unique processes for solving assembly challenges. Whether traditional electronics assembly, die attach or emerging applications, such as flexible and formable electronics, Alpha designs solutions for manufacturing that looks at how multiple products can interact in the same environment to provide customers with the most effective assembly solution for their application.
